Call Of Duty New Game 2024 Reddit. Microsoft's top brass revealed the release window for 2024's call of duty game at a recent meeting, according to a report. 1.3m subscribers in the callofduty community.


Call Of Duty New Game 2024 Reddit

Next 2024 dropped in with new details about what to expect from call of duty: 1.3m subscribers in the callofduty community.

Call Of Duty New Game 2024 Reddit Images References :